Charlton v Coventry stopped after plastic pigs thrown on pitch

Charlton and Coventry fans threw hundreds of plastic pigs on the pitch in a joint protest that interrupted Saturday's match at The Valley.

The supporters were protesting against the two League One clubs' respective owners, and had also organised a joint march to the stadium before the game.

Play was delayed for about five minutes while the pigs were cleared.

Charlton went on to win the match 3-0, meaning Coventry remain bottom.

Fans of the London side have made repeated protests against owner Roland Duchatelet's running of the club.
